… Hello !
Longship is not using UnityDoorstep anymore, if you want to use Longship,
you will first need to install BepInEx's mod injector.
You can find more inflammations about the new installation process here:
https://github.com/AlexMog/Longship#manual-installation
And the installation of BepInEx can be found here:
https://valheim.thunderstore.io/package/denikson/BepInExPack_Valheim/
(taka a look at "Manual Installation" part)
